COSMOS Trial: Daily Multivitamins Significantly Slow Biological Aging Clocks

A prespecified analysis of the large-scale COSMOS trial has found that daily multivitamin-multimineral supplementation significantly slows markers of biological aging in older adults. The study provides robust clinical evidence that standard nutritional interventions can influence cellular longevity and epigenetic health beyond simple deficiency prevention.
